Give It A Makeover

There weren’t a lot of Galaxy S10e colors to choose: Prism Blue, Prism Black, Prism White and Flamingo Pink. Other locations around the world had two extra options of Prism Green and Canary Yellow.

Anyone who is not in love with theirS10e’s color should check these out and see how they can make their phone pop.  Set Up The Fingerprint Reader

One of the first things you should do with your Galaxy S10e is to set up the fingerprint reader as your primary security measure. Someone can find out your lockscreen’s password or unlock gesture, but you can rest assured that they won’t have a mold of your fingerprint. When it comes to security, this is your strongest bet.

Go into your Settings. Then go into the Biometrics and Security, and then tap into Fingerprints. You can set up the reader to recognize up to four of your fingerprints. It makes it easier to unlock, depending on how you’re holding your phone at the moment.

 Unlike the rest of the S10 series, the Galaxy S10e has a side-mounted fingerprint reader instead of an ultrasonic in-screen fingerprint scanner. Some users have found that they like this old-fashioned fingerprint sensor better than the scanners on the S10e’s higher-priced counterparts. The only problem with the sensor is that it can be trickier for left-handed users to unlock the screen one-handed.

Get A Better Wallpaper

The Samsung Galaxy S10e is a smartphone that’s gotten a lot of praise for its features, performance and price. It does have one tiny problem that a lot of users don’t like: the almost bezel-less screen has a hole-punch to fit the front-facing camera. It’s not a massive eye-sore, but a lot of users don’t like the look of the little black circle in the corner.

While you can’t get rid of the hole-punch, you can disguise it with a clever wallpaper. Download the app Hidey Hole to get wallpapers sourced from Reddit users to camouflage the camera cut-out. If you’re a big fan of sci-fi, use a wallpaper of C3P0 or a Dalek to cover up the circle. If you love comics, then use one where the hole-punch acts as an eye-patch for Nick Fury or Thor.
